Transaction 22ecd40f900a3989e6d2d1ee3195d895c4d0faa118d4b2a0dd995467ac95b218
1 Input
1 Output
-
22ecd40f900a3989e6d2d1ee3195d895c4d0faa118d4b2a0dd995467ac95b218:0
- value
- 18452975
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d6daf29be4c3e5dd2727b607d8865f546297fa7 OP_EQUAL
- address
- 3BfcyStiPM3ECwaDkC6iSzCrBz9ShTFNx6